tag_insight = "The following packages are affected:
   linux-png
   png

CVE-2004-0421
The Portable Network Graphics library (libpng) 1.0.15 and earlier
allows attackers to cause a denial of service (crash) via a malformed
PNG image file that triggers an error that causes an out-of-bounds
read when creating the error message.";
